For Your Eyes Only is Moore's best James Bond movie because it has a serious tone. The producers were too involved in schtick during most of the 70's and 80's. Moore is a much better actor than those movies allowed.
I think Daniel Craig has been the quintessential Bond but I do believe that Pierce Brosnan, if given the chance to be in all three movies that feature Craig, would have given an equally excellent performance. He too was stuck with dopey schtick. Christmas comes twice a year? |
